It's hot and humid here in SCT too! but if I turn the heat lamps off, they huddle up together, piling up on eachother, so I leave it on....BTW, it's 80°F in the room where my brooders are and they still want heat!
I have various aged chicks in different brooders, all the way from just hatched to 6 week olds, all in the 80°F room. After 4 weeks I have been turning the heat off of them but if I do before that, they will bunch up, even in an 80°F environment.
